Output c8251365901080401fea81f1ca2b82588ddfd1bb44f0ad81090c21d94a49798d:0

value
513459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 097a629a38fadbf171d887638b16c128695b6213 OP_EQUAL
address
32Z8cjuhTKNwT2zapWTEMfg2X9hgzLZKgs
transaction
c8251365901080401fea81f1ca2b82588ddfd1bb44f0ad81090c21d94a49798d
confirmations
345884
spent
true